I do not know if it will be useful is the advice given by a Sony Vaio VGN-CR120E / W that I found online. At least, you can send to the station to the Sony. Sure that all open programs are closed. Make sure all network connections are disconnected. Make sure all devices are disconnected. NOTE: If the computer using a CD / DVD, make sure the player is connected according to the instructions of the Guide VAIO. User VAIO Application Center, under Pick a program recovery, click Create recovery. Disk NOTE: The VAIO Recovery Center can be accessed from the Windows Help and Support. Click and recovery, then Save launch VAIO Recovery Center. Next to Create Recovery Discs window, click the Start button. In the recovery discs needed When the window, click the Next button. In the Choose your media, click the Next button. NOTE: Even if an option is provided for creating Dual Layer (DL), this option does not produce usable discs on this model. Make sure the recovery disk set (s) with … DVD (s) is selected before click Next. Insert a blank recordable DVD into the DVD player. In the window Insert a blank disc, click the OK button. Insert a new disc when necessary according to instructions. When all disks have been created, click the Finish button. NOTE: After recovery disks were created first, all Discs can be created by selecting the disk in the list and click Next.
